     Despite starting a but later than planned, I had a nice little morning. Of the thousand words, I would say some 750 were "new" creation, the rest were bits of "old stuff" that I added back in, and then mashed around a bit.

     One of the problems I ran into in the first attempt was that there is a good deal of character interaction going on in the early stages of the book, and I was never able to get fully into things so the characters were coming out flat (in my opinion--which I suppose you'll have to take, since I'm the only one reading what I've written at this point!). So I've really tried to focus myself here yesterday and today. I've done a good bit of detailed thinking about feelings and about perspectives, and all that stuff. I feel closer to the three main characters than I did before, though I'll admit I still need depth in a few places.

     So, I've got work to do there.

     The proof will be more evident one way or the other by the end of the week, I suppose. If, by then, I feel in tune with the characters, then I know I'll be fine. If I'm still struggling, then I've probably got a real problem.

     Of course, I've yet to hit the parts of the story where I felt I had even bigger issues--those being large worldview/political wheeling and dealing of governments and other various factions. I'm hoping the outlining work I did in the week prior to starting this will hold up. And I think it will.
